The three permanent decisions first, and for each: the answer, the reasoning, and the alternatives named explicitly. Organizations and item master. A dedicated item master and three inventory organizations — then the case for folding the central store into Assembly. Both are defensible. The item model. The class hierarchy, and explicitly that the traceability requirement drives class design less than people expect. The cost structure. One cost organization with two books — then the case for two cost organizations given the different cost character of the two plants. This is the closest call in the brief. Then the remaining design decisions, and here things are actually solved rather than listed. The overhead basis: machine-hour absorption at Fabrication, labour-hour at Assembly, via work-center-level rates.
